Quantitative analysis of siliceous microfossils in 210Pb-dated Lake Michigan sediments shows five time zones in microfossil abundance and composition. Sediments deposited before 1885 contain low abundances comprising species associated with very oligotrophic lakes. In Khoy ophiolitic massif (NW of Iran) three types of quartzite and also quartz bearing veins can be distinguished: massive quartzite, quartz bearing veins in the amphibolites and siliceous veins in the radiolarian cherts. [1] Magnetite dissolution, and consequent loss of magnetization, is widely observed in reducing sedimentary environments, where the decrease in Eh-pH values with depth is driven by bacterially mediated degradation of organic carbon. An abundant and diversified assemblage of siliceous loose sponge spicules has been identified in the Late Eocene deposits cropping out along the southern coasts of Australia. In this work, we present a Grand Canonical Monte-Carlo simulation results for the adsorption of carbon vapour in the pores of faujasite zeolite (in its siliceous form). The carboncarbon interactions are described within the frame of a Tight Binding approach (fourth momentum’s method) while the carbon-zeolite interactions are modelled using a PN-TrAZ physisorption potential.
